Independent multiboxing on two computers?
How do I and my wife multibox independently on two different computers? Let's say I run account 1 and 2 on computer A and she runs account 3 and 4 on computer B. We launch two separate Character Sets but use the same keymaps.
I would have expected a keymap to only affect the game instances launched by the specific Character Set, or at least execute only on the computers specified in the Character Set (defaulting to local PC only if no computers are set), but it seems that Innerspace still connects all computers on the LAN and all mapped keys are broadcasted to all computers that happens to be running. This means that we can't multibox independently.
Is there a good way for me to solve this problem without having to resort to making a complete copy of all Mapped Keys that sends to two separate Action Target Groups?
Or does Innerspace need a code change to support this?
